Snake Bite Prevention and Immediate First Aid Training Successfully Concluded

On Friday, Shrawan 23, the Nepal Youth Red Cross Circle of Agriculture and Forestry University, Rampur, successfully conducted an informative and practical training session on snake bite prevention and immediate first aid.

The program was attended by over 88 enthusiastic participants, including students, volunteers, and trainers, who actively engaged in learning life-saving techniques and preventive measures against snake bites—a matter of great importance in the community.

Trainers Mr. Yamlal Bhandhari, Mr. Dev Prasad Pandey, and Mr. Nar Bahadur KC enriched the session with their expert guidance, real-life examples, and interactive demonstrations, making the training both engaging and impactful.
